This is such a great campsite, plenty of space for kids to play and make friends, but small enough that one of the toilet blocks is always nearby. Talking of which, the toilets and showers are very modern, spacious and clean. The site was pretty quiet after 10pm, only downsides were no obvious recycling facilities.Really nice little shop with lots of local treats and friendly staff. There was a horsebox bar, mobile pizza oven and musicians playing on a couple of days during our stay (May half term). The campsite being so close to Weymouth and the Dorset coast meant day trips were easy to organise. We'll definitely go back - it'll be hard to find a better campsite.
